What Happened in San Francisco on Saturday, January 31st, 2026
Yesterday in San Francisco, police responded to 156 incidents, down 20% from 195 the day before. 20 violent crimes were reported, and officers made 42 arrests.
The most common incident type was Administrative, accounting for 60 of 156 reports (38% of total). The most active neighborhood was Tenderloin with 21 incidents.
Activity was roughly in line with the 30-day average of 164 incidents per day.

Arrests
San Francisco police made 42 arrests yesterday. 3 arrests were related to violent incidents.
Arrests accounted for 27% of all incidents. Of the 42 arrests, 17 were Administrative, 7 were Drugs & Alcohol, and 5 were Traffic & Vehicles. This is up 2% from the 41 arrests the prior day.

Hourly Breakdown
Activity in San Francisco yesterday peaked between 5 PM – 6 PM with 16 incidents during that hour.
Overnight (12–6 AM) saw 27 incidents, morning (6 AM–12 PM) had 32, afternoon (12–6 PM) had 53, and evening (6 PM–12 AM) had 44. Afternoon was the busiest period overall.
Saturdays in San Francisco typically average 160 incidents. Yesterday's total of 156 is 4 incidents below that 8-week average (2% lower).
